emirates7 - A magnitude 5.4 earthquake struck northeastern Pakistan on Thursday.
The European-Mediterranean Seismological Centre (EMSC) said the epicentre was located 260 kilometres northeast of the city of Battagram, at a depth of 35 kilometres.
No casualties or damage were immediately reported.
